WSA Procurement Portal provides crucial opportunity for savings

The Welsh Sports Association Sport and Leisure Procurement Portal, powered by 2buy2 and open to both WSA and Community Leisure UK (CLUK), can support organisations to make significant savings.

The WSA has worked with strategic partners CLUK, establishing solutions to support the sector amid the financial challenges faced since the onset of COVID-19 and now the cost-of-living crisis.

To support members through the existential threats posed by current financial challenges, the Procurement Portal offers great opportunities to make economies of scale.

The procurement portal provides self-service access to a range of approved supplier lists, framework agreements, quotes and pricing from pre-accredited suppliers. There will also be access to a series of best practice procurement guides, templates, and procedures free of charge for WSA and CLUK members.

There are opportunities available through 2buy2’s existing product categories, including electricity, gas, water, chemicals, telecoms, cleaning products, IT support, HR support, solar solutions, broadband and more! Additional demand-led services and products will continue to be added to the portal as and when required.

Many organisations in Wales have already been taken of advantage of the Procurement Portal.

One grassroots club, the Race Association Football Club â€“ a club affiliated to the FAW – announced this month that, courtesy of the partnership between the WSA and 2buy2, they made significant savings on their energy costs.

The club confirmed that, through 2buy2, they’d had a saving of 60% on unit price with a 29% saving on standing charge!
